Formerly civilized planets, or worlds, now outside the boundaries of civilization.

Description (Specifications)

This is a fairly generalized and generic term referring to frontier worlds outside the core settled areas of Charted Space.

History & Background (Dossier)

The term arose during the later stages of the Civil War, referring to worlds between the fronts of the various factions.

  • While nominally part of the sphere of control of one faction or another, none of the forces had the spare forces to maintain control and the worlds became essentially independent.
  • After the release of the Virus and the Collapse, the number of civilized areas was reduced to one, the Regency. The wilds are inhabited by the remains of the former Imperium, but no one knows what will be encountered in the Wilds.
